Prairie Farms Dairy, Inc. Recruiter Contact FAQ

How do I find the right recruiter at Prairie Farms Dairy, Inc.?

Search LinkedIn for "recruiter Prairie Farms Dairy, Inc." or "talent acquisition Prairie Farms Dairy, Inc.". On Prairie Farms Dairy, Inc.'s LinkedIn page, click "People" and filter by job title. Look for recruiters who specialize in your function (e.g., "Engineering Recruiter at Prairie Farms Dairy, Inc.").

When is the best time to reach out to Prairie Farms Dairy, Inc. recruiters?

Tuesday through Thursday mornings (9-11 AM in the recruiter's timezone) typically see the highest response rates. Avoid Mondays when Prairie Farms Dairy, Inc. recruiters are catching up on emails, and Fridays when they're wrapping up the week.

Should I contact Prairie Farms Dairy, Inc. recruiters before or after applying?

Apply to Prairie Farms Dairy, Inc. through official channels first, then reach out to a recruiter referencing your application. This shows initiative and gives Prairie Farms Dairy, Inc.'s recruiter something to look up. Mention the role title and date you applied.

What if a Prairie Farms Dairy, Inc. recruiter doesn't respond?

Give Prairie Farms Dairy, Inc.'s team 5-7 business days before following up. Send one polite follow-up, then move on. Silence doesn't always mean rejection - Prairie Farms Dairy, Inc. recruiters are often managing many candidates. You can try reaching a different Prairie Farms Dairy, Inc. contact for a different role later.
